Suzanne Moore
Artist’s manuscript. Softcover, handsewn. Cloth-covered box with handwritten and painted title pastedown on the spine. H368 x W178 mm. 17 pages. A unique edition. Acquired from the artist, 15 April 2024.
Photos: Books On Books Collection and artist.

Dreamings (2023) follows the artist’s Question Series, begun in 2008 considering questions of life and art while exploring the letter Q – “that quirky letter of distinct design” as Moore calls it. Other works in the series include:

Thirteen Questions  (2008), drawn from Pablo Neruda’s The Book of Questions (1991) [Libro de las preguntas (1974)], unknown location.*

Studies in Love the Question (2016), now at the Letterform Archive.

Inquiry (2019), unknown location.*

Seeing Red: Seven Questions (2019), unknown location.*

Trust (2019), now at the Boston Athenaeum.

The Question (2021), drawn from Rainer Maria Rilke’s Letters to a Young Poet. Now at Baylor University.

Your Question, Please (2022), unknown location.*

Rescuing Q (2023), now at the Bodleian Libraries.

Tord Nygren
Hardback, casebound, sewn. H305 x W 215 mm. [30] including pastedowns. Acquired from Better World Books, April 2025.
Photos: Books On Books Collection.

The Swedish expression “den röda tråden” translates best as “the common thread”, the thing that links together otherwise disparate things and experiences. The literal translation, however, works best for Tord Nygren’s Den Röda Tråden (1987), leaving us to follow the red thread that the clown offers to the children on the front cover. The thread wraps around to the pastedown and across the fly leaf chased by the runaway carousel horse …
